The worry tree

By Musgrove, Marianne

Publishers Summary:
Juliet is a worrier, but when constant bickering between her and her younger sister leads Juliet to move into her own bedroom, she discovers the worry tree her grandmother used as a girl to relieve her own concerns.

When Juliet, the likable protagonist of The Worry Tree, feels stressed, her skin prickles, and she breaks out in a nervous rash. Her many worries, such as her desire for her parents not to argue or for her friends to get along with each other, are believable concerns for a ten-year-old. The Worry Tree, meanwhile, provides an ingenious coping method. Painted on the wall of Juliet’s room when her great-great-grandmother was a girl, the tree holds six animals.
